Description

Legacy of Rescue: A Daughter's Tribute is an illustrated intergenerational memoir of the author’s father, Morton (Miksa) Fuchs, and Zoltán Kubinyi, the Commanding Officer who saved him and over 100 Hungarian Jewish men in forced labor under his command during the Holocaust. Captured as a POW by the liberating Russian Army, Zoltán Kubinyi, a devout Seventh Day Adventist, died a year later in a Siberian labor camp and was buried in an unmarked grave. Because of Morton Fuchs’ testimony, he was posthumously honored as a Righteous Among the Nations by Yad Vashem, the Holocaust Memorial Museum in Jerusalem.

The story of rescue came full circle in the summer of 2011 when the author and her brother took their children back to Hungary to meet the rescuer's family. With the rescuer’s son - an infant when his father went off to war - his wife and teenage great granddaughters of Zoltán Kubinyi, they discussed the heroic actions of this compassionate and courageous man none of them knew but who has made such an indelible impact on all their lives.

Legacy of Rescue is a story that inspires all of us to make a difference in everyday life.
